A cookie manufacturer wants to claim that its chocolate chip cookies have the most chips in each cookie. to make this claim each cookie must have at least 25 chocolate chips. A 1-pound bag of chocolate chips contains 500 chips. How many cookies can the company make using 10 pounds of chocolate chips?

10 pounds of chocolate chips contains 10*500 = 5000 chips.

Each cookie must contain at least 25 chocolate chips. Therefore, the toal number of cookies that the company cam make is 5000/25 = 200
